Redline Rush - Game Overview

Redline Rush from Red Tiger Gaming puts you in the cockpit of a sports car tearing towards a neon-lit city skyline. It gave me strong Grand Theft Auto vibes the moment I loaded it up. The 3D visuals are genuinely sharp, and the whole thing feels immersive with the driver's perspective and city lights reflecting off the dashboard. The 'Call Me' lipstick note on the windshield is a nice cheesy touch.

Mechanically it is straightforward. You are working with a 5-reel, 3-row grid and 20 fixed paylines. Stakes run from 10p to 20 pounds per spin. The default RTP sits at 95.8%, which is a touch below average, and the hit frequency is a decent 34.98%. Red Tiger label it high volatility, though in my experience it plays more medium-high. The max win is 2,813.5x the bet, which is honestly not going to blow anyone's socks off.

Symbols and Paytable in Redline Rush

Low pays are neon-styled 10 through Ace card royals. Five of a kind with these gets you 2x to 2.5x the bet, so nothing exciting there. The high-paying symbols are Exhaust Tips, a Headlight, a Wheel, a Woman, and a Male Driver. A full line of five high pays awards between 3x and 125x the bet, with the Driver character sitting at the top.

The Wild is a blazing Engine symbol that appears on all reels, substitutes for every paying symbol, and pays 125x the bet for a five-of-a-kind line. The Scatter is a Free Spins badge that triggers the bonus round when you land three or more. During the speedometer mechanic, winning symbols are removed from the grid and new ones tumble down, which can chain into further wins.

Bonus Features in Redline Rush

The centrepiece feature is the Speedometer, a 5-level meter above the reels. Each consecutive win during a tumble sequence bumps the speed up one level. Level 2 gives a 2x multiplier, Level 3 a 3x, Level 4 a 5x, and Level 5 keeps the 5x but removes all low-paying royals from the reels entirely. That last level is where things get interesting, though it took me roughly 180 spins to first reach it in the base game.

A forgiving touch is that if the speedometer hits Level 3 or above, a non-winning tumble does not end your spin outright. Instead, it drops one level and clears everything except Wilds and Scatters for another cascade. Only a non-winning tumble at Level 2 actually ends the round. It keeps the action ticking over nicely.

Free Spins are triggered by landing 3, 4, or 5 Scatters for 3, 6, or 12 spins respectively. The bonus plays at the max speedometer level throughout, meaning a constant 5x multiplier and no royals cluttering the reels. Retriggering is possible with the same scatter counts. If you are impatient, you can buy straight into Free Spins for 80x the bet, though the buy feature RTP drops slightly to 95.73%.

Redline Rush - Final Verdict

I had a decent enough time with Redline Rush, but it did not blow me away. The speedometer mechanic is a clever spin on rising multipliers and tumble wins, and reaching Level 5 genuinely feels rewarding. The visuals are some of the best Red Tiger have produced recently. Where it falls short is the max win. At 2,813.5x, it lacks the supercharged potential you would expect from a slot marketed as high volatility. It plays more like a steady, eventful session than a volatile thrill ride.

If you are a petrolhead who enjoys the theme and does not mind a capped ceiling, it is worth a go. But if you are chasing massive win potential, this one might leave you wanting more horsepower under the bonnet.
